Apple has released its picks for best apps of 2015. The company picked Periscope (our runner up for App of the Year) as its iPhone App of the Year — calling it a game-changer that “made sharing and watching live videos an instant obsession” — and selected photo editor Enlight and stock-trading app Robinhood as its runners-up. Workflow won Most Innovative app for iPhone, and Instagram’s 3D Touch enhancements won it Best App on iPhone 6s.
Lara Croft GO won Best Game of the Year for iPhone for its “beauty and clever design,” with Fallout Shelter and Mr Jump earning runner-up honors. Dark Echo was listed as the Most Innovative iPhone game and “immersive 3D Touch controls” won Warhammer 40,000: Freeblade honors as Best Game on iPhone 6s.
Apple picked The Robot Factory (our runner up for Best Kids App) as its iPad App of the Year, with HBO Now and Patterning: Drum Machine finishing as runners up. Most Innovative iPad App went to LiquidText PDF and Document Reader.
Best App on iPad Pro went to 3D design app uMake. Prune won Best iPad Game of the Year, ahead of runners-up Rayman Adventures and Implosion – Never Lose Hope. Her Story was named Most Innovative game for iPad and Zodiac: Orcanon Odyssey was the Best Game on iPad Pro.
